EXCEEDS logo
Exceeds
Jonathan Lacefield

PROFILE

Jonathan Lacefield

Worked on the temporalio/terraform-provider-temporalcloud repository, delivering five features over three months focused on Terraform provider development, documentation, and security. Built a ServiceAccount Information Data Source in Go, enabling users to audit service account permissions directly from Terraform. Enhanced documentation across repositories, clarifying API key handling, role semantics, and onboarding processes, while aligning product documentation with actual provider capabilities. Improved contributor guidelines and acceptance testing instructions to streamline external contributions and reduce misconfigurations. Emphasized best practices for API security and infrastructure as code, leveraging Go, HCL, and Markdown to ensure maintainable, secure, and accessible workflows for both users and contributors.

Overall Statistics

Feature vs Bugs

100%Features

Repository Contributions

9Total
Bugs
0
Commits
9
Features
5
Lines of code
1,243
Activity Months3

Work History

January 2025

1 Commits • 1 Features

Jan 1, 2025

January 2025 — Focused on expanding IAM visibility and governance in the Temporal Cloud Terraform provider by delivering a new ServiceAccount Information Data Source. This feature enables users to fetch service account details and their associated namespace permissions directly from Terraform, improving auditing and access control. The work includes data source implementation, schema, provider integration, comprehensive documentation, and acceptance tests, delivered as part of the temporalio/terraform-provider-temporalcloud repository. Commit 9a6cd638ab4e4c6ebf45ae6e818088114b956e40 documents the initial support for this data source (#237).

December 2024

2 Commits • 2 Features

Dec 1, 2024

December 2024 monthly summary focused on aligning product documentation with actual capabilities and improving external contribution workflows. Delivered targeted documentation cleanup, clarified API Key handling in Terraform, and strengthened acceptance testing/PR guidance for the Terraform Cloud provider. Business value includes reduced support friction, improved onboarding for external contributors, and tighter governance of testing processes.

November 2024

6 Commits • 2 Features

Nov 1, 2024

November 2024 performance summary: Focused on documentation quality, security posture, and contributor onboarding for the Temporal Cloud Terraform ecosystem across two repositories. Delivered key features in provider docs, improved handling of sensitive API keys, clarified role semantics and admin/owner behavior, and established contributor guidelines. Enhanced Temporal Cloud Terraform Provider documentation with practical setup instructions and examples for Namespaces, Users, Service Accounts, and API Keys, including best-practices to keep configurations in a single .tf file to prevent permission overwrites. No critical bugs reported; efforts reduce misconfigurations, streamline onboarding, and improve maintainability. Technologies leveraged include Terraform provider development, IaC documentation, security-conscious data handling, and cross-repo documentation coordination.

Activity

Loading activity data...

Quality Metrics

Correctness98.8%
Maintainability98.8%
Architecture98.8%
Performance97.8%
AI Usage20.0%

Skills & Technologies

Programming Languages

GoHCLMarkdown

Technical Skills

API IntegrationAPI SecurityCloud InfrastructureCommunity ManagementData Source ImplementationDocumentationGoTechnical WritingTerraformTerraform Provider Development

Repositories Contributed To

2 repos

Overview of all repositories you've contributed to across your timeline

temporalio/terraform-provider-temporalcloud

Nov 2024 Jan 2025
3 Months active

Languages Used

GoHCLMarkdown

Technical Skills

API SecurityCloud InfrastructureCommunity ManagementDocumentationTerraformTerraform Provider Development

temporalio/documentation

Nov 2024 Dec 2024
2 Months active

Languages Used

Markdown

Technical Skills

DocumentationTechnical WritingTerraform